Matcha Marmorkuchen

Zutaten für eine Kuchenform

• 250g Dinkelmehl oder glutenfreies
• 60g gemahlene Mandeln
• 1 geh. TL Backpulver
• 120 g unraffinierter Zucker
• 1 TL gem. Vanille
• 30 g Ahornsirup
• 200 ml Hafermilch (Zimmertemperatur)
• 1 TL Apfelessig
• 100g flüssige, vegane Butter
• 2 TL Health Bar Matchapulver

preparation

Preheat the oven to 180 degrees Celsius (top and bottom heat). Grease a bundt cake pan with vegan butter or neutral coconut oil.

First, mix the dry ingredients in a bowl. Blend the oat milk with the apple cider vinegar and let it sit for 2 minutes. Then add the oil and syrup and mix with the dry ingredients from the bowl to form a smooth dough.

Fill half of the dough into the greased pan.

Stir the Matcha into the remaining batter and fill it into the mold as well.

Mix the Matcha dough with the base dough using a fork. Bake in the oven for 40 minutes. Let it cool down completely before removing it from the mold.

Optional:

Top with melted Health Bar Matcha chocolate and garnish with chopped hazelnuts!
